Taylorsville to Anchorage

Updated: 28 May 2026

The distance from Taylorsville to Anchorage is over 3,000 kilometers, making flying the only practical mode of transport. You will need to travel to Salt Lake City International Airport for a flight to Ted Stevens Anchorage International Airport. The flight typically takes about 5 to 6 hours with a connection. Anchorage is the gateway to Alaska's wilderness, offering incredible opportunities for hiking, wildlife viewing, and glacier tours. Always book your flights well in advance for this long-haul journey.

Travel Tips
  • Daylight
    In summer, enjoy nearly 20 hours of daylight; bring an eye mask for sleeping.
  • Clothing
    Dress in layers, even in summer, as the weather can change quickly.
  • Wildlife
    Always keep a safe distance from wildlife; carry bear spray if hiking.
  • Transportation
    Rent a car to explore the areas outside of Anchorage.
  • Booking
    Book your rental car well in advance, as they sell out quickly.
Safety Tips
  • Bear Safety
    Learn how to store food properly and use bear-resistant containers.
  • Weather
    Be prepared for sudden weather changes; check forecasts daily.
  • Emergency
    Keep your phone charged and have a satellite communicator if hiking in remote areas.
  • Navigation
    Download offline maps as cell service is limited outside of Anchorage.
